#203dde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#203dde is composed of 12.5% red, 23.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 230.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#203dde color hex could be obtained by blending #407aff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#203dde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#203dde has RGB values of R:32, G:61,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2112990.

Shades and Tints of #203dde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020410 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#203dde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787a86 is the less saturated color, while #0329fb is the most saturated one.
